**Job Description**

AECOM is seeking a talented and experienced **Design Manager** to be based out of any AECOM office with some telecommuting and expected travel. The qualified candidate will oversee a wide variety of colocation and **hyper-scale data center projects** from site due diligence, campus planning, conceptual/schematic/detailed design through construction documents, and construction administration. The ideal candidate has experience managing the design of colocation and hyper-scale data centers, has a background in electrical engineering, or mechanical engineering, and possesses exceptional written and verbal communication skills.

AECOM is a leader in the global data center consulting industry with robust teams in the Americas, Europe, Africa, Asia, and Australia. In this role, you will have the opportunity to work with our teams around the world on high-profile, fast-paced data center projects for global clients. This is a hands-on, client-facing role with an opportunity for upward career mobility.

**Job Responsibilities**

+ Lead data center due diligence and design teams to deliver projects that meet the client’s requirements, on schedule and to a high degree of quality. Design disciplines will include architecture, civil, structural, mechanical, electrical, plumbing, security, fire protection, ICT, and BMS/EPMS.

+ Develop and enforce multi-site project and program management plans.

+ Host and attend meetings with clients and external stakeholders.

+ Proactively manage and communicate change throughout the project both within AECOM and to our clients.

+ Identify problems early and develop creative solutions.

+ Proactively communicate with all stakeholders to provide project updates and resolve outstanding issues.

+ Develop technical and financial proposals for new and add/move/change data center design projects
